Output 76169eccb32d512035c64e5ee50a0e2505dae9bafea61edbfc6ccf873de1db66:14

value
18170918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580a74c907a0d2bcbad2712a5b4eb3c09321291e OP_EQUAL
address
39iXuw7dBeiJm5u9ooswCVHfrpSwXW6Gb1
transaction
76169eccb32d512035c64e5ee50a0e2505dae9bafea61edbfc6ccf873de1db66
spent
true